Starting the Day: From Hanoi to Yen Wharf
The tour begins early, with hotel pickups from Hanoi’s Old Quarter around 7:30 to 8:30 AM. This includes a private bus and guide, making the journey smooth and comfortable—no worries about navigating busy streets or arranging transportation. The drive itself is pleasant, with a short 25-minute stop halfway for a quick refresh, giving you a moment to stretch and prepare for the next leg.
The Scenic Boat Ride Along Yen Stream
Arriving at Yen Wharf around 10:30 AM, your adventure takes a peaceful turn. Boarding a local boat, you’ll glide through Yen Stream—an experience many travelers describe as a highlight. The boat rides through lush forested landscapes, offering a chance to relax and appreciate the scenery. Some reviewers mention the views are truly “picturesque,” with tranquil waters and greenery creating the perfect backdrop for photos.
Trekking or Cable Car Up to Huong Tich Cave
Once ashore, the next step is a trek up Huong Son Mountain or a cable car ride—your choice, at your expense. The hike involves walking through a forested trail, with some reviewers mentioning it’s a moderate climb but rewarding with scenic vistas. The cave itself, Huong Tich, is renowned for its impressive stalactites and spiritual atmosphere.
Travelers note that the cable car option can save time and energy, especially if you’re not keen on an uphill walk. However, many say the hike offers a more immersive experience, blending exercise with nature. The cave is considered a significant spiritual site, and visiting it feels like touching a piece of Vietnam’s religious soul.
Lunch in Local Mountain Cuisine
After the exploration, the tour includes a stop at a rustic restaurant, where you’ll enjoy traditional dishes from Northeastern Vietnam. Reviewers often mention the “authentic flavors” and simple but hearty meals, which provide a perfect break and a taste of local life. It’s a great chance to rest, refuel, and discuss the morning’s highlights with fellow travelers.

Visiting Thien Tru Pagoda
Post-lunch, the journey continues to Thien Tru Pagoda, built in the 18th century. This spiritual site offers a glimpse into Vietnam’s religious architecture and history. The pagoda, meaning “heaven kitchen,” is notably historic, and some visitors appreciate its tranquil setting amid natural surroundings.
Return to Hanoi
Your day concludes with a scenic drive back to Hanoi, arriving around 4:30 to 5:00 PM. The entire experience, including transfers, guide commentary, and sightseeing, tends to last approximately 8 hours.

Is hotel pickup included?
Yes, the tour offers pickup from select Old Quarter hotels in Hanoi, making it convenient for travelers staying in the area.
How long does the entire tour last?
The full experience runs approximately 8 hours, starting around 7:30-8:30 AM and returning in the late afternoon.
Can I choose the cable car instead of trekking?
Yes, the cable car is available as an alternative option at your expense, allowing a more relaxed ascent to Huong Tich Cave.
Do I need to buy an admission ticket?
Admission tickets are not included, so you’ll pay for entry to the sites on the day. The guide will assist with this.
What should I wear?
Comfortable clothing suitable for walking and hiking is recommended. Since you’ll visit religious sites, modest attire covering shoulders and knees is advisable.
Is this tour suitable for children?
Most travelers can participate, but consider the physical activity involved—stairs and walking may be challenging for very young children.
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, the tour offers free cancellation up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und.
What is the maximum group size?
The group is limited to 25 travelers, ensuring a more intimate experience.
Are meals included?
Lunch at a local restaurant is included, featuring rustic dishes from Northeastern Vietnam.
Will I have free time during the tour?
The schedule is well-paced, focusing on key highlights, so free time is limited but ample for photos and brief explorations.
